Factors Affecting Cost
House raising in Keego Harbor, MI, involves elevating a structure to protect against flooding, improve foundation stability, or comply with local regulations. The scope and complexity of such projects can vary based on several factors, including materials used, size of the home,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ners plan effectively.
- Materials: Common materials include steel beams, concrete piers, and wood supports, selected based on the home's size and foundation type.
- Size and Scope: The scope ranges from small single-story homes to larger multi-level structures, affecting the overall project duration and effort.
- Labor Complexity: The process requires careful structural assessment, precise lifting techniques, and coordination of multiple trades, contributing to project complexity.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Keego Harbor typically require permits for house raising, which involve inspections and adherence to building codes.
- Additional Considerations: Extra tasks such as utility disconnects, foundation repairs, or modifications to access points may add to the overall project scope and cost.
